Subject: Greenhouse controller cut-over — done

Team,

Cut-over of the Fernvault greenhouse controller to the Bryloft stack finished last night. Context for new folks: the old humidity sensors drifted ~3% per month, so setpoints crept and vents over-fired. New controller recalibrates nightly against the reference probe in Bay 2. Old hardware stays powered but ignored for two weeks, then gets pulled. Alerts route to the Fernvault channel as before. The controller now runs with the following values:

deployment values, kajep-kageg:
[praix]
host = praix.paliqcorp.corp
user = praix_svc
database = praix_prod

# Break-Glass: Catalog Cache Invalidation

Scope: the Pinrow product catalog at Veldstone Retail. If stale prices persist after a purge and the Hollowmere invalidation queue is wedged, use break-glass to flush the edge tier directly. Contractors: get verbal sign-off from the catalog lead first. Steps: open the Hollowmere admin shell, select emergency-flush, confirm the tenant, and run it once — repeated flushes thrash the origin. Access is logged and expires after 20 minutes. Unseal the admin shell with the passphrase below.

recovery phrase for kahop-tajog: istix-casvan

## Tuning Assignment Behaviour

The Splitbeam assignment service hashes subject identifiers into experiment buckets deterministically, so plugin authors can rely on stable assignments across sessions. Plugins may adjust cache and rebalance behaviour within the bounds the core service enforces; values outside those bounds are clamped at load time and logged. The enforced defaults and bounds are given in the following table.

tuning table, yajog-yahof:
BUDGETS = {
    "lamvan": 303,
    "wenox": 460,
    "fenvan": 525,
}

Meeting notes, Sketchloom editor team: undo/redo will move from snapshot-based history to a command pattern with inverse operations. Snapshots were costing too much memory on large diagrams. Each mutation now registers its inverse at commit time; grouped gestures collapse into a single undo step. Redo stack clears on any new edit, as before. The migration spans three releases. Future questions about the history subsystem go to the maintainer named below.

account owner for bawip-tahag: Raleth Quenok